The Comeback Cats, Inc. is a 501 (c)(3) dedicated to protecting, uplifting, and advocating for stray and feral cats in Newark, NJ and surrounding areas. We're committed to the compassionate, ethical stewardship of homeless animals by providing them with loving care, safe shelter, and a nurturing environment. We aim to educate and empower others to practice responsible pet care and the humane treatment of all animals, fostering a culture of kindness and respect towards all creatures.

Tessa is one of those unforgettable stray cats who found her way into my heart—and into the heart of our community. I first met her as a tiny, fragile kitten when her mother, Mama Cat, brought her and her siblings to our backyard. Back then, The Comeback Cats Inc. was just an idea, but I knew I had to help her.
When I found Tessa again, she was outside a crack house, nursing her own litter. What broke my heart even more was learning that her kittens were being sold by the people living there to fuel their addiction. When they caught wind of my attempts to rescue her, they locked down the place, and for a while, I thought I’d lost her forever.
Then, just two months ago, as if guided by some gentle miracle, Tessa showed up at our door. She remembered her name and came right to me, like she never forgot who cared for her. I was able to bring her inside, where she is being aptly cared for.
Tessa’s story is a beautiful testament to the strength and hope that stray cats carry with them—One day, she'll be placed in a loving, forever home where she'll never again suffer the hardships of the streets.
